Benefits of Using Raised Garden Beds for Better Soil Control
Raised beds offer superior soil management capabilities compared to traditional gardening methods. Gardeners can create custom soil mixtures using high-quality compost, vermiculite, and organic matter without being limited by existing ground conditions. This control extends to pH levels, nutrient content, and drainage characteristics, ensuring optimal growing environments for specific plant varieties. The elevated structure also provides better drainage, preventing waterlogged roots and reducing the risk of soil-borne diseases. Additionally, the contained soil warms up faster in spring, extending the growing season and improving germination rates.
Easier maintenance represents another significant advantage, as the raised height reduces bending and kneeling required for planting, weeding, and harvesting. This ergonomic benefit makes gardening more accessible for people with mobility limitations or back problems. The defined edges also create clear pathways, preventing accidental damage to plants and making garden navigation more efficient.
Cost-Effective Raised Garden Bed Options for Different Budgets
Practical solutions exist for various budget ranges, from simple DIY constructions to professionally installed systems. Basic raised beds can be constructed using untreated cedar boards, which offer natural rot resistance and attractive appearance. Alternative materials include composite lumber, concrete blocks, or even repurposed materials like old pallets or logs. The initial investment varies significantly based on size, materials, and construction complexity.

Design Considerations and Setup Ideas
Successful raised bed implementation requires careful planning regarding size, location, and accessibility. Standard dimensions typically range from 3-4 feet wide to allow easy reach from both sides, with lengths varying based on available space. Height considerations depend on intended crops and user needs, with 8-12 inches suitable for shallow-rooted vegetables and 18-24 inches better for deep-rooted plants or accessibility requirements.
Location selection should prioritize areas receiving 6-8 hours of direct sunlight daily while considering water access and drainage patterns. Proper preparation includes leveling the ground, installing hardware cloth to prevent burrowing pests, and ensuring adequate spacing between multiple beds for maintenance access.
Material Selection and Durability Factors
Choosing appropriate materials significantly impacts both initial costs and long-term maintenance requirements. Cedar and redwood offer natural rot resistance without chemical treatments, making them safe for food production while providing 10-15 years of service life. Composite materials resist decay and insects but may cost more initially. Metal options like galvanized steel provide excellent durability and modern aesthetics but require proper drainage considerations to prevent rust.
Avoid pressure-treated lumber containing harmful chemicals that can leach into soil and affect plant health. Whatever material you choose, proper construction techniques including corner reinforcement and adequate drainage will extend the lifespan of your investment.
